Yas School is currently seeking to recruit a high-performing Lead Teacher (Literacy) to join our team in August 2026 for the AY 2026-2027 or sooner if possible.

This is an exciting opportunity to join a flagship government school in Abu Dhabi with the mission of blending Emirati cultural values with modern global standards to create an exceptional educational experience for our students. Our ideal candidate will be passionate about upholding our school’s values while embracing the rich culture and heritage of the UAE. At Yas School, we deliver the Ministry of Education (MOE) curriculum and have a special focus on inclusive education, enrichment and preparing future ready learners. Founded in 2015, we are the largest single-campus K-12 government school educating 1750+ girls and boys on our extensive campus.

We are seeking a proven practitioner, with expertise in UK or US curricula, and ideally experience with the UAE Ministry of Education (MOE) curriculum.

As a Lead Teacher, you will be responsible for leading whole-school and/or cycle specific initiatives within the following areas aligned to your area of expertise: instructional leadership, curriculum development, monitoring and assessment, professional development, communication and integration of technology.

The successful candidate should:

• Bachelor’s Degree in Education or Post Graduate Diploma in Education

• Master’s Degree in Education/Educational Leadership or a related field is an advantage

• Proficiency in English (demonstrated by a minimum IELTS score of 6 or equivalent)

• Bilingual skills (English & Arabic) are highly desirable

• UAE Certified Teaching License/ equivalent, or working towards attainment

• At least 4 years of classroom teaching experience

• A minimum of 2 years’ experience in an academic middle leadership role

• Proven experience in formal or informal leadership focused on improving student achievement
